Understanding Brake Dust: Composition, Causes, and Consequences
Before diving into removal methods, it’s crucial to understand what brake dust is and why it’s so problematic. Brake dust is primarily composed of metallic particles from your brake pads and rotors as they wear down during braking. This friction creates a fine powder that adheres to your wheels and surrounding surfaces. The composition of brake dust varies depending on the type of brake pads used, but it commonly contains iron, carbon, and other metallic compounds.
The Science Behind Brake Dust Formation
The braking process generates immense heat and pressure, causing the brake pads to gradually wear away. As the pads rub against the rotors, tiny particles are released into the air and quickly settle on nearby surfaces. These particles are often highly abrasive and can embed themselves into the clear coat of your wheels, making them difficult to remove.
Different Types of Brake Dust and Their Impact
The type of brake dust produced depends largely on the type of brake pads installed. Here’s a quick overview:
- Metallic Brake Pads: Produce a dark, gritty dust that is highly corrosive and prone to sticking to surfaces.
- Semi-Metallic Brake Pads: Similar to metallic pads but with a slightly reduced metallic content.
- Ceramic Brake Pads: Generate a lighter-colored dust that is less abrasive and easier to remove.
- Organic Brake Pads: Produce a less visible dust but may not offer the same level of braking performance.
The impact of brake dust goes beyond aesthetics. If left unaddressed, it can cause permanent damage to your wheels, including:
- Corrosion: Metallic brake dust can react with moisture and oxygen, leading to rust and corrosion.
- Etching: Abrasive particles can scratch and etch the clear coat, dulling the finish.
- Staining: Brake dust can penetrate the surface of the wheels, causing unsightly stains that are difficult to remove.
Therefore, regular and effective brake dust removal is essential for maintaining the appearance and longevity of your wheels.
The Best Way to Remove Brake Dust: A Step-by-Step Guide
Now that you understand the nature of brake dust, let’s explore the best way to remove brake dust. This process involves several key steps, from preparation to cleaning and protection. We’ll cover both basic and advanced techniques to suit your specific needs and skill level.
Step 1: Preparation and Safety Precautions
Before you begin, gather the necessary supplies and take safety precautions:
- Supplies: Wheel cleaner (specifically designed for brake dust), microfiber towels, wheel brushes (various sizes), a hose with a spray nozzle, a bucket of clean water, and gloves.
- Safety: Wear gloves to protect your hands from harsh chemicals. Work in a well-ventilated area. Avoid spraying wheel cleaner on hot surfaces or in direct sunlight.
Step 2: Rinsing and Pre-Cleaning
Start by rinsing your wheels with a hose to remove loose dirt and debris. This will prevent scratching during the cleaning process. Use a strong spray nozzle to dislodge stubborn particles. Next, pre-clean the wheels with a mild soap and water solution. This will help to loosen the brake dust and make it easier to remove.
Step 3: Applying Wheel Cleaner
Apply a wheel cleaner specifically formulated for brake dust removal. Follow the manufacturer’s instructions carefully. Some wheel cleaners are designed to change color as they react with brake dust, indicating that they are working effectively. Let the cleaner dwell for the recommended time, but don’t allow it to dry on the surface.
Step 4: Agitating and Scrubbing
Use a variety of wheel brushes to agitate the brake dust and loosen it from the surface. Pay close attention to hard-to-reach areas, such as lug nut recesses and intricate wheel designs. Use a smaller brush for tight spaces and a larger brush for broader surfaces. Avoid using abrasive brushes that could scratch the wheels.
Step 5: Rinsing Thoroughly
Rinse the wheels thoroughly with a hose to remove all traces of wheel cleaner and brake dust. Ensure that no residue remains, as this could cause staining or corrosion. Use a strong spray nozzle to flush out any remaining particles.
Step 6: Drying and Inspection
Dry the wheels with a clean, soft microfiber towel. Inspect the wheels for any remaining brake dust or stubborn stains. If necessary, repeat the cleaning process or use a more aggressive wheel cleaner. Pay attention to any areas that require extra attention.
Step 7: Applying Wheel Protectant
To prevent future brake dust buildup, apply a wheel protectant or sealant. This will create a barrier that makes it easier to remove brake dust and protects the wheels from corrosion and staining. Follow the manufacturer’s instructions for application. Consider using a ceramic coating for long-lasting protection.
Choosing the Right Wheel Cleaner: A Product Guide
Selecting the right wheel cleaner is crucial for effective brake dust removal. There are various types of wheel cleaners available, each with its own strengths and weaknesses. Here’s a breakdown of popular options:
- Acid-Based Wheel Cleaners: Highly effective at removing stubborn brake dust but can be corrosive and damaging to certain wheel finishes. Use with caution and always test in an inconspicuous area first.
- Alkaline-Based Wheel Cleaners: Safer for most wheel finishes but may not be as effective on heavily soiled wheels.
- pH-Neutral Wheel Cleaners: Gentle and safe for all wheel finishes, but may require more agitation and scrubbing.
- Iron Removers: Specifically designed to dissolve iron particles, making them highly effective for removing brake dust.
When choosing a wheel cleaner, consider the following factors:
- Wheel Finish: Ensure the cleaner is compatible with your wheel finish (e.g., painted, chrome, aluminum).
- Severity of Brake Dust: Choose a stronger cleaner for heavily soiled wheels and a milder cleaner for regular maintenance.
- Safety: Opt for a pH-neutral or alkaline-based cleaner for maximum safety.

Advanced Techniques for Stubborn Brake Dust Removal
Sometimes, basic cleaning methods aren’t enough to remove stubborn brake dust. In these cases, you may need to employ advanced techniques:
Clay Bar Treatment
A clay bar can be used to remove embedded brake dust and contaminants from the surface of your wheels. Simply lubricate the wheel with a clay bar lubricant and gently rub the clay bar over the surface. The clay bar will lift away the contaminants, leaving the wheel smooth and clean.
Polishing
If your wheels have minor scratches or swirl marks from brake dust, polishing can help to restore their shine. Use a wheel polish and a polishing pad to buff the surface of the wheels. Be sure to follow the manufacturer’s instructions carefully.
Iron Removal
Iron removers are specifically designed to dissolve iron particles, making them highly effective for removing brake dust. Spray the iron remover on the wheels and let it dwell for the recommended time. The iron remover will turn purple as it reacts with the iron particles. Rinse thoroughly with water.
Preventing Brake Dust Buildup: Proactive Measures
The best way to remove brake dust is to prevent it from building up in the first place. Here are some proactive measures you can take:
- Use Low-Dust Brake Pads: Consider switching to ceramic or organic brake pads, which produce less brake dust than metallic pads.
- Apply Wheel Protectant Regularly: Wheel protectants create a barrier that makes it easier to remove brake dust and protects the wheels from corrosion.
- Wash Your Wheels Frequently: Regular washing will prevent brake dust from building up and becoming difficult to remove.
- Avoid Aggressive Braking: Aggressive braking generates more heat and friction, leading to increased brake dust production.

- Q: How often should I clean my wheels to remove brake dust?
A: Ideally, you should clean your wheels every 1-2 weeks to prevent brake dust buildup. This will make it easier to remove and prevent permanent damage.
- Q: Can I use household cleaners to remove brake dust?
A: It’s not recommended to use household cleaners, as they may contain harsh chemicals that can damage your wheels. Always use a wheel cleaner specifically designed for brake dust removal.
- Q: What’s the best way to clean wheels with intricate designs?
A: Use a variety of wheel brushes in different sizes to reach all the nooks and crannies. A detail brush can be particularly helpful for cleaning tight spaces.
- Q: How can I protect my wheels from brake dust?
A: Apply a wheel protectant or sealant regularly to create a barrier that makes it easier to remove brake dust and protects the wheels from corrosion.
- Q: Are ceramic brake pads worth the investment?
A: Ceramic brake pads are a great investment if you want to reduce brake dust and enjoy quieter braking performance. They also tend to last longer than metallic pads.
- Q: What’s the difference between acid-based and pH-neutral wheel cleaners?
A: Acid-based wheel cleaners are highly effective at removing stubborn brake dust but can be corrosive. pH-neutral wheel cleaners are safer for all wheel finishes but may require more agitation.
- Q: Can brake dust damage my car’s paint?
A: Yes, brake dust can damage your car’s paint if it’s allowed to sit on the surface for too long. It can cause etching, staining, and corrosion.
- Q: What’s the best way to remove brake dust from plastic wheel covers?
A: Use a mild soap and water solution and a soft brush to clean plastic wheel covers. Avoid using harsh chemicals or abrasive cleaners.
- Q: How can I prevent brake dust from sticking to my wheels?
A: Apply a wheel protectant or sealant regularly to create a non-stick barrier that prevents brake dust from adhering to the surface.
- Q: What are the signs of brake dust damage on my wheels?
A: Signs of brake dust damage include corrosion, etching, staining, and a dull or faded finish.
